The distinction depends on your program, yet both accreditations allow you to exercise dental care. The majority of oral institutions are 4-year programs. The very first 2 years will generally be classroom discovering, taking topics such as anatomy, biochemistry and biology, microbiology, radiology, and oral pathology. The following 2 years will be professional training, where students research study under a trained dental practitioner to learn just how to treat people.

This list contains programs in the U.S. and copyright: almost all states approve Canadian orthodontic training, however those with orthodontic training from other countries will likely have to finish their education and learning once again in the united state before practicing dentistry or orthodontics in America. The residency program is 3-5 years, relying on the institution.


By the end of a residency program, orthodontists will have taken part in thousands of orthodontic therapies, providing them a thorough expertise of this specialty. Some orthodontic residencies pay their locals, while others need settlement. If there is pay, it is usually in the type of a gratuity, which is a fairly tiny yearly fund to cover some basic living costs and/or travel to seminars.

After you have successfully finished an orthodontic residency, you'll be prepared to begin practicing orthodontics. To do so, you need to have passed the national oral board examination, as well as the state licensing demands in the state where you intend to practice. The licensing requirements for orthodontists are the same as for dental experts.
